Meteorological data from a United States Coast Guard (USCG) exposed location buoy (ELB) 美国海岸警卫队(USCG)外露定位浮标(ELB)的气象资料
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160137
D. Smith
This paper addresses the integration of a National Data Buoy Center (NDBC) meteorological payload with the recently developed United States Coast Guard (USCG) 9-foot by 35-foot Exposed Location Buoy (ELB) and the Subsequent testing of this buoy in a severe ocean environment. The ELB is designed as a navigation aid capable of being deployed in exposed offshore locations that experience severe environmental conditions. A comprehensive testing prograrn of the integrated ELB will be performed in a severe environment near a certified meteorological platform. The testing program objective will be to certify the buoy/payload system for operational use on platforms of opportunity in environments of significant meteorological interest.

Air independent power systems for autonomous submarines 自主潜艇不依赖空气的动力系统
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160294
H. Nilsson
United Stirling AB (USAB), the world leader in Stirling external combustion engine development and Kockums AB are jointly testing in a full scale submarine test section a new 100 kW Stirling engine, the V4-275R, for the Royal Swedish Navy. The engine is integrated with a liquid oxygen storage and a closed cycle combustion system is provided for underwater propulsion. The successful development of a pressurized combustion system using diesel fuel and oxygen for the Stirling engine has lead to the next stage - a contract for installation of two V4-275R engines in a large, manned diver lock-out submarine, the SAGA I. This 500 ton commercial prototype, developed in France jointly by COMEX and CNEXO, is to be completed by 1986. It will demonstrate the "all-underwater" solution for various undersea tasks. Missions of up to 25 days submerged will be possible. The Swedish Navy intend to continue their Stirling program and a system for testing on naval submarines has been contracted.

Mapping the exclusive economic zone 绘制专属经济区地图
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160219
R. Perry
The NOAA multibeam surveys of the Exclusive Economic Zone (EEZ) are providing a new data base and map series that are significantly superior to existing bathymetric maps compiled from prior surveys, particularly in areas of complex relief. The new Sea Beam and Bathymetric Swath Survey System (BSSS) surveys are designed to give essentially 100 percent coverage of selected areas on the continental shelf, slope, and upper rise off the west coast of the U.S. These areas were selected through a cooperative agreement between NOAA and the Department of Interior's U.S. Geological Survey (USGS). The first complete map at 1:100,000 has been compiled from surveys between39deg30'N and40deg00'N. It shows the sinuous submarine canyons in remarkable detail. The San Andreas fault does not appear to extend north of Point Delgada. The NOAA multibeam surveys run in tectonically-active areas such as the west coast continental margin are developing detailed data sets that will be of great value to economic development and to a better understanding of the geologic framework of those areas.

Sea beam sidelobe interference cancellation 海波束旁瓣干扰消除
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160131
D. Alexandrou
The Sea Beam multibeam bathymetric system is in operation aboard research vessels worldwide. While it has contributed greatly in advancing the understanding of the deep-sea floor, several types of bathymetric artifacts have been identified in its contoured output which could be mistaken for sea floor structure. Among those, the "tunnel" effect results from sidelobe interference caused by the near specular return and is most prominent when the sea floor is relatively flat. It is characterized by a trough in the bottom profile produced by Sea Beam. It will be shown that this type of interference can be greatly reduced or eliminated through an adaptive filtering scheme, pending a minor modification of the Sea Beam data acquisition system. The noise-cancelling configuration of the adaptive least-squares lattice filter will be used to process simulated Sea Beam data obtained through REVGEN, a high-fidelity sonar system simulation program.

Maintenance dredging alternatives for estuarine harbors 入海口港口的维修疏浚方案
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160253
D. Skelly
Worldwide maintenance dredging is a growing concern because of increasing dredging costs and strict environmental constraints, with spoils disposal areas diminishing. The Center for Coastal Studies at Scripps Institution of Oceanography, under past sponsorship of the Naval Facilities Engineering Command and current sponsorship of the Office of Naval Research, has been developing sedimentation control systems as an alternative to maintenance dredging. The key to designing and developing these systems is to understand the physical processes that lead to sedimentation. This paper examines some of these processes responsible for sedimentation in estuarine waterways and briefly discusses the development, use and performance of innovative sediment control systems.

Advancements in remotely controlled underwater vehicles 遥控水下航行器的进展
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160173
A. Billet
Technological improvements during the past six years have increased several times the operational capabilities of Remotely Operated Vehicles in underwater work. These vehicles are used for inspection, debris removal, object retrieval, and structural cleaning. With this expanded use has come similar dramatic new technology for the vehicle systems. This extends the vehicle operational capabilities and gets more power into a very small package. This entire 400 Hz powered hydraulic propulsion system weight (including all items such as thrusters, motor, pump, valves, etc.) is equal to just the electric motor/pump package of existing 60 Hz powered systems. To obtain higher vehicle performance in a smaller packager, higher power voltages and frequencies are used. A high speed electric motor driving a miniature variable delivery hydraulic pump for the propulsion system produces 10 HP in a 16.6-lb. package. Similar size and weight reductions are made in the thruster motor/servo valve packages. The smaller size of these vehicles may preclude the necessity of a dedicated support vessel.

Enhanced soundings over oceans from NOAA-9 polar orbiting satellite NOAA-9极轨卫星加强海洋探测
Pub Date : 1900-01-01 DOI: 10.1109/OCEANS.1985.1160236
A. Swaroop, A. Nappi, Z. Ahmad, M. Chalfant, L. McMillin, A. Reale
Global temperature soundings have been produced by NOAA at 250 Km resolution utilizing the data from HIRS/2, MSU, and SSU instruments aboard NOAA polar orbiting satellites. This 250 Km resolution is too coarse to provide enough information in meteorologically active regions such as frontal systems. An Enhanced sounding system has been developed to produce soundings at a much higher resolution (approximately 100 Km) and has been tested in a near real-time operational environment. Test results and case studies over ocean areas are presented and compared with TOVS data, NMC analyses and oceanic radiosonde data where available. The results have depicted the small scale meteorological features quite well. The high resolution soundings provide the increased horizontal gradient information useful for numerical weather prediction models especially in data sparse regions such as the world oceans.
